Death toll rises to three in Rohini building collapse

Rescuers recovered two more bodies from the rubble of two collapsed buildings in Rohini Sector 16 on Thursday, bringing the death toll to three. The structures fell on Wednesday afternoon.

The deceased were identified as Ram Dua, 62, husband of one of the plot owners; Kafe Mohammad alias Nurul, 24, a labourer who had started work at the site two days earlier; and Ram Kishan, 42, a passerby on a motorcycle.

Police registered a case under Section 105 of the Bharatiya Nyaya Sanhita for culpable homicide not amounting to murder. Deputy Commissioner of Police Shashank Jaiswal said the rescue operation was almost over and the cause remained under investigation.

The four-storey buildings, under construction for about a year on adjacent plots in Rohini Sector 16, collapsed around 4.20 pm on Wednesday. Family members of the deceased waited at Baba Saheb Ambedkar Hospital for the bodies after post-mortem.
